TP钱包收款二维码深度解析:故障排查、合约性能与数字化系统最佳实践

简介:

TP钱包(TokenPocket等钱包生态)收款二维码作为链上/链下收款的交互入口,承载着商户收款、用户付款及会计对账的关键流程。本文从故障排查、合约性能、市场态势、交易通知以及高效与先进数字化系统设计等角度,给出系统性的分析与实操建议,帮助工程、产品与运营团队把控收款二维码相关风险与体验优化。

一、故障排查(从表象到根因的系统化流程)

常见问题:二维码无法识别、收款地址错误、金额不匹配、网络超时、交易上链失败或回滚、代币不被支持、链选择错误。

排查步骤:

- 客观复现:用不同设备、不同摄像头、不同钱包扫描,排除终端兼容性;

- 验证二维码内容:解析二维码字符串,检查格式(链ID、合约地址、金额单位、备注、nonce等);

- 校验链与代币:确认用户钱包支持目标链与代币(主链/测试链区分);

- 网络与节点:检查RPC节点连通性、节点返回延迟及TPS瓶颈,查看是否因节点限流导致交易提交失败;

- 合约回退检查:抓取失败交易的revert reason(用eth_call、debug_traceTransaction工具),排查合约逻辑或代币合约的限制(如黑名单、冻结、转账钩子);

- 签名与nonce:检查客户端签名算法、交易nonce顺序及重放防护;

- 日志与链上证据:关联交易哈希、区块确认数与事件日志(Transfer/PaymentReceived等)。

二、合约性能与可扩展性考量

关键性能点:gas成本、事件与日志过滤效率、合约函数复杂度、批量处理能力。

优化策略:

- 精简合约逻辑,避免在转账路径进行复杂计算;将可验证计算移到链下,仅在链上做状态写入与事件触发;

- 支持批量结算(batch transfer)以摊薄每笔开销;

- 使用代付Gas(meta-transactions)或ERC-2612风格的Permit签名减少用户操作成本;

- 设计轻量事件(包含最小必要字段)便于后端高效索引;

- 评估Layer2/侧链与Rollup方案,将高频小额收款迁移至低成本层,降低主链拥堵风险;

- 测试并设定gas limit与gas price策略,使用自动化压力测试与合约覆盖率工具。

三、市场分析报告(面向产品与业务决策)

趋势洞察:区块链收款在B2C与B2B中增长分化明显,零售侧用户对体验敏感(扫码即付、即时确认),B2B更关注对账与合规。

竞争与机会:传统扫码支付(如支付宝/微信)在用户基数与合规上占优,但加密收款对跨境、低手续费和代币化资产有天然吸引力。可行策略包括聚合多链收款、提供一键法币结算、与支付服务商合作提供浮动费率。

风险与合规:反洗钱(AML)、KYC、税务报告与跨境监管需嵌入产品策略,市场教育和合作伙伴关系是规模化关键。

关键KPI:支付成功率、首笔成功时间、平均确认时延、失败原因分布、手续费占比、商户留存率。

四、交易通知与用户体验优化

通知要点:及时性、准确性与可验证性。实现建议:

- 多渠道推送:App推送、短信、邮件与Webhook,确保商户与用户均能接收到交易状态变更;

- 确认策略:区块链交易以“pending→1 conf→final(N conf)”的多阶段通知模型告知用户;

- Mempool与重放监控:在交易进入mempool时通知,并追踪是否被替换(replace-by-fee)或被矿工忽视;

- Idempotency与补偿:通知与后端处理要做到幂等,失败时支持重试与人工补偿流程;

- 安全与隐私:通知中避免泄露敏感地址与完整交易数据,提供可验证的交易哈希供核验。

五、高效数字系统架构(工程实现层面)

基础架构要素:消息队列(Kafka/RabbitMQ)解耦、RPC池与负载均衡、可伸缩索引器(链上事件扫描)、关系型/时序数据库分层存储、缓存策略(Redis)。

可靠性设计:熔断、限流、重试策略与回滚;日志与分布式追踪(Jaeger/Zipkin);SLA与自动化报警;对账系统定时比对链上事件与业务库数据。

扩展实践:微服务拆分(收款处理、通知服务、合约交互、清结算),按照领域模型划分边界,支持水平扩展与灰度发布。

六、先进数字化系统与未来演进

技术前沿:Layer2支付通道、zk-rollups用于支付隐私、智能合约钱包(账户抽象)、链下发票与发票标准化(可链下签名、链上结算)。

智能化能力:引入异常检测(机器学习)识别异常收款模式、动态费率定价、自动化合规筛查与风控评分。

开放生态:提供标准化SDK、REST/WebSocket API、可视化商户控制台与对账导出功能,构建合作伙伴网络(支付网关、会计软件、法币清算)。

结论与建议清单:

- 建立标准化的故障排查手册与自动化自检工具;

- 在合约层面优先考虑成本与可扩展性,评估Layer2方案;

- 设计分阶段的交易通知机制并保证幂等性;

- 架构上采用异步消息与可观测性平台,确保高可用与可追踪;

- 将合规与市场策略并举,利用SDK与合作伙伴快速拓展商户生态。

结合上述策略,团队可在保障安全与合规的前提下,逐步提升TP钱包收款二维码在性能、体验与市场竞争力上的表现。

作者:林泽宇发布时间:2026-01-01 21:07:54

评论

CryptoLiu

很系统的分析,尤其是合约性能和Layer2迁移的部分,对工程落地很有指导意义。

晓风

故障排查清单非常实用,建议补充各链常见RPC异常的排查示例。

Evelyn

市场分析切中要点,法币结算与商户教育确实是规模化瓶颈。

张瑞

交易通知那块解决了我们长期困扰的确认时延问题,计划参考实现多阶段通知。

NodeHunter

期待后续能给出具体的压力测试脚本和合约重构示例代码。

相关阅读
<tt draggable="k68tah"></tt><bdo draggable="vtr_l2"></bdo><em id="1ap5zw"></em><strong date-time="0g8qt8"></strong><tt draggable="_1k7wj"></tt><strong dropzone="l4sqyn"></strong>
<ins lang="i6okn"></ins><dfn date-time="sn2xa"></dfn><code date-time="5hu6w"></code><b lang="37jkb"></b><ins draggable="8o5i_"></ins>
<ins date-time="6c6h"></ins>